Topic: Working with Project Templates and Master Slides in Adobe Captivate 5.5

Description: Join Dr. Pooja Jaisingh and Vish to learn how to use project templates and master slides to give a consistent look and feel to your projects and templatize the slides you frequently use in Adobe Captivate 5.5 courses.

What’s in it for you?

After attending the session, you will be able to:

  • View master slide.
  • Add a master slide.
  • Add objects to master slides.
  • Edit master slides.
  • Reuse master slides.
  • Create project templates.
  • Create projects from project templates.
  • Add master slide in project template.

How to replace current slides with new slides. For example, you may have a project complete with recording created from a MS Powerpoint file that you did not link to the original PPT file. Now you want to replace the background slides after making some alterations in the PPT file but there is no way you want to add the new slides, then copy/paste the recordings, etc. The shortest way to do this is to Create an New project, adding the revised PPT files fro the project.
Next, you can save the project then Export the new file to Flash CS5. This with all Adobe Captivate Elements for Export turned OFF except for the Slide backgrounds. Once you have done this, you will have a separate Flash CS5 file (SWF) for each slide image. In the Library, Right Click the Flash image by name under Media. Those are the SWF files. After right-clicking select PROPERTIES and then UPDATE. You can go get the new image and replace the current one with the new one. The recordings, etc. will remain intact. Hope this helps someone save time and effort!
